Controversial Malaysian rapper-actor Namewee is believed to have faked his “death” on April Fool’s Day. Two minutes after midnight on April 1, a black-and-white photo of the 40-year-old was uploaded to social media with the phrase “1983 - 2024”. Arif-Roy King second best in Spain Masters

PETALING JAYA: Men’s doubles pair Wan Arif Wan Junaidi-Yap Roy King fell at the final hurdle of the Spain Masters in Madrid on Sunday. Arif-Roy King battled hard against Sabar Karyaman-Moh Reza Pahlevi but could not stop the Indonesians from securing a 21-18, 17-21, 21-19 win in 52 minutes.
